EDUCAST, The University of Roehampton, London, successfully hosted a high-level educational event, the “Vice Chancellor Meet & Greet 2026,” at the Bagmati Ballroom in Kathmandu. The exclusive gathering served as a strategic platform for top-tier university executives, prominent educational consultants, and key industry stakeholders to discuss expanding global academic pathways and strengthening support systems for Nepalese students aspiring to study in the United Kingdom.
The event was highlighted by the presence of a distinguished delegation from the UK, led by University of Roehampton Vice-Chancellor, Prof. Jean-Noël Ezingeard. Accompanying the Vice-Chancellor were key executive members, including Vidhi Mistry, Executive Director of Partner Relations & Growth; Guillaume Richard, Group Director (Commercial); and Tom Girandon, Regional Manager for South Asia. Niraj Gurung, Marketing Manager for The Official Representative supporting the university, was also present to facilitate the high-profile interactions.
During the session, the visiting university leadership shared valuable insights into Roehampton’s evolving academic offerings, modern campus infrastructure, and specialized student support frameworks. The delegates emphasized their commitment to providing Nepalese students with a seamless transition into the UK higher education system, ensuring both academic excellence and robust post-study professional opportunities.
Addressing the gathering, Dr. Deepak Khadka, CEO and Founder of The Official Representative Limited, expressed his profound gratitude to the University of Roehampton team for their continuous investment and engagement in the Nepalese market. Dr. Khadka also extended his heartfelt thanks to the attending educational agents and consultancy partners, praising their dedication and pivotal role in maintaining professional, ethical, and transparent recruitment pathways. The event concluded with an interactive networking session focused on future collaborations and emerging trends in international student recruitment.
